Disco I/Disco II Motor Swap

SpdDemon426
November 8, 2009
 25
 3
Description:
These are some photos from my dad's machine shop on a motor swap he did for me. I just got a 98 Disco I, bought it with a blown motor and he had a Disco II engine that he put in for me.

The engine was from an 02 Disco II that had like 30 thousand miles on it and it has been laying around for years, so we decided to freshen it up with new piston rings, lifters and bearings.

This is the first part of our project, We are also going to chop up the front end and replace it with an 04 front that he got from an auction for practically nothing. (something i don't think is possible and i don't want done anyway) It has a salvage title and the motor and tranny are missing from it. We sold everything off of it except for the head lights, bumpers and grill..

I will post those pictures when we start doing that. Disclaimer, I am not a mechanic, I am 18 and still learning. If anyone has any questions, i will answer them to the best of my ability, before asking the old man. Its 3am and im bored i hope you guys enjoy.

This was the only mechanical problem they ran into.  The crank sensor in the disco II was seated too far to catch a signal, so they popped that plug off the Disco I that you see there and welded it on the Disco II motor.
